Georgia football extends offer to top linebacker recruit

11 April 2026
in Sports
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ter



The Georgia Bulldogs have extended a scholarship offer to Robert “Tre” Geathers III, a three-star recruit in the class of 2027 and a standout linebacker. Geathers III is the son of Robert Geathers II, a former Georgia player who enjoyed a successful NFL career with the Cincinnati Bengals. The younger Geathers, who plays for Providence Day School in Charlotte, North Carolina, is recognized as the No. 537 recruit nationally and the No. 17 prospect in North Carolina. He recently showcased his skills with impressive statistics during his junior season, including 72 tackles and three interceptions. While Georgia has a strong recruiting history with family ties, Geathers III is also being pursued by other programs, including South Carolina and Florida, making his recruitment a competitive scenario for the Bulldogs.

Why It Matters

Geathers III’s recruitment is significant due to his familial connection to the University of Georgia and the legacy of his father, who contributed to the program during a successful era. The Bulldogs have historically benefited from recruiting players with strong family ties to the school, but recent trends show that some legacy recruits have chosen other institutions. Geathers III’s performance at Providence Day and his versatility as an athlete enhance his appeal for college programs. His decision could impact Georgia’s recruiting strategies as they seek to maintain a competitive edge in attracting top talent.
